- 1âKeep Poundingâ originated from former Panthers linebacker and coach Sam Millsâ inspirational speech in 2003 while he battled cancer, and it has since become the franchiseâs core rallying cry.
- 2Panthers fans often bring multiple generations of family members to games, making parentâchild game-day posts a recurring and beloved theme in team fandom.
- 3The Panthers tap their #KeepPounding culture before home games by having a special guest hit the âKeep Poundingâ drum, further reinforcing the sloganâs emotional weight.
